A bomb threat was reported on another Vistara flight -UK-131 from Mumbai, India, and the flight with 107 passengers, one infant, and 8 crew onboard landed safely at the Bandaranaike International Airport (BIA) today, Airport and Aviation Services said.
Accordingly, all passengers were swiftly evacuated from the A-320 aircraft to the passenger terminal building, and the safety of all passengers was assured, the department said.
This is the second such incident where the same Indian passenger flight made an emergency landing at BIA on October 19 following a bomb threat which turned out to be a hoax after a thorough security search, officials said.
The Vistara Airlines flight carrying 96 passengers and eight crew members was heading from Mumbai to Colombo. It made an emergency landing 10 minutes before the scheduled time of 3 p.m on October 19.
